What is a numerical expression?

Back

A numerical expression is a mathematical phrase that includes numbers and operations but no variables.

What is an algebraic expression?

Back

An algebraic expression is a mathematical phrase that includes numbers, variables, and operations.

What is the difference between a numerical expression and an algebraic expression?

Back

An algebraic expression has variables and a numerical expression does not.

Write an algebraic expression for the number of eggs in d dozen if there are 12 eggs in a dozen.

Back

12d

Write an algebraic expression for the cost of entering a state park with a $6.00 entry fee and $7.50 per night of camping for n nights.

Back

6 + 7.50n
